WebDuckworth created the Grit Scale, a self-assessment that looks at one's perseverance and passion. She says that "when taken honestly, [it] measures the extent to which you approach your life with grit." In 2004, during her second year of graduate school, Duckworth began studying first-year cadets at the United States Military Academy at West Point. Our culture is obsessed with natural talent, but Angela Duckworth’s research has found that consistent effort matters more, which she labels grit. Grit is a combination of: remaining interested in one … WebSummary. At the beginning of this chapter, Duckworth poses the question of whether grit is inherited. The short answer is in part. Duckworth explores the idea that grit is both genetic and influenced by experience, as are many of our traits.
